Yet the two-hour program produced precisely the opposite effect. Instead of demonstrating unity and strength, the two men tore apart each other\u2019s arguments and, in the process, exposed the deep divisions at the heart of the regime and the severe weakness those divisions reveal.<\/p>\n<p>Some people in Western capitals will want the familiar script: a &#8220;pragmatic&#8221; camp against a &#8220;hardline&#8221; one, with the lesson that the first must be rewarded. That reading is a fabrication. Nothing here resembles the loyal disagreement of a democracy, where rivals contest policy and still share a floor. The cameras captured two factions of one apparatus accusing each other of treason, of foreign money, of destroying the state \u2014 men fighting over wreckage each suspect will not survive the next war.<\/p>\n<p>The regime\u2019s internal rift has now reached the very office on which the entire system rests. In a televised program\u2014 something once unthinkable \u2014 even the authority of the Supreme Leader was openly called into question. Sabeti had publicly claimed that the Islamabad accord was \u201cimposed\u201d on him. Shahriari immediately described the statement as \u201can open insult to the Leadership\u201d. Yet Sabeti refused to retreat: \u201cIt is something I have said, and I am saying it again now. It is not an insult; it is the truth.\u201d In a system built on the supposedly absolute authority of the <em>velayat-e faqih<\/em>, a parliamentary deputy can now declare on television that the <a href=\"https:\/\/thehill.com\/homenews\/5930872-iran-supreme-leader-mou-reservations\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Supreme Leader was overruled<\/a>. What was once an untouchable taboo has become part of the regime\u2019s public infighting \u2014 a striking measure of how far its internal divisions and erosion of authority have advanced.<\/p>\n<blockquote class=\"twitter-tweet\" data-width=\"550\" data-dnt=\"true\">\n<p lang=\"en\" dir=\"ltr\">&quot;As internal factions wage intense political warfare over tactical <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/hashtag\/MoU?src=hash&amp;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">#MoU<\/a> concessions and hereditary succession, the fundamental crises driving the historic wave of popular uprisings since 2017 remain entirely unaddressed,&quot; writes Dr, <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/MasumehBolurchi?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">@MasumehBolurchi<\/a>. <a href=\"https:\/\/t.co\/L5sGY8fPAp\">https:\/\/t.co\/L5sGY8fPAp<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&mdash; NCRI-FAC (@iran_policy) <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/iran_policy\/status\/2066756854059814977?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">June 16, 2026<\/a><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><script async src=\"https:\/\/platform.x.com\/widgets.js\" charset=\"utf-8\"><\/script><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Shahriari insisted the Foreign Minister was the leader&#8217;s personal pick: &#8220;Mr. Araghchi was chosen by the Leader himself, and the next day Mr. Araghchi told me the Leader had summoned him.&#8221; Sabeti&#8217;s answer was a shrug at the throne: &#8220;Suppose the Leader whispered in your ear to make Araghchi minister&#8230; my legal duty is to oppose any minister.&#8221; Shahriari, defending the leader&#8217;s authority, ended up confessing its emptiness: &#8220;The Leader has said in a hundred places, &#8216;I say my view and you do as you please.'&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Then there is what Sabeti wants. He does not want leverage; he <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ncr-iran.org\/en\/news\/terrorism-a-fundamentalism\/the-iranian-regime-needs-war-for-its-survival\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">wants the war<\/a> continued. Negotiation, he says, is &#8220;a necessary evil&#8221; at best, and if the enemy will not deal, &#8220;then you must fight, obviously.&#8221; He faults the regime for reopening the Strait of Hormuz and wants it shut again, with Bab al-Mandab, to break global supply chains: &#8220;The Strait of Hormuz is my strategic instrument.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">His revenge list extends past Israel and the United States to Arab neighbors: &#8220;the leaders and the palaces of the senior officials of every single Arab country&#8221; that hosted American forces &#8220;must be targeted.&#8221; Asked whether power should mean license, he answered plainly: &#8220;If we have power, we must do it \u2014 I am thinking realistically.&#8221; Shahriari&#8217;s retort was the most honest sentence of the night: &#8220;God forbid America&#8217;s power ever fell into your hands.&#8221;<\/p>\n<blockquote class=\"twitter-tweet\" data-width=\"550\" data-dnt=\"true\">\n<p lang=\"en\" dir=\"ltr\">&quot;In recent weeks a severe political <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/hashtag\/crisis?src=hash&amp;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">#crisis<\/a> has erupted within Iran\u2019s ruling establishment as the state <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/hashtag\/television?src=hash&amp;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">#television<\/a> network, the IRIB, systematically censors top state figures while airing calls to prosecute sitting leaders,&quot; writes Farid Mahoutchi.<a href=\"https:\/\/t.co\/BKxtIYHkAP\">https:\/\/t.co\/BKxtIYHkAP<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&mdash; NCRI-FAC (@iran_policy) <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/iran_policy\/status\/2081051600349479310?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">July 25, 2026<\/a><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><script async src=\"https:\/\/platform.x.com\/widgets.js\" charset=\"utf-8\"><\/script><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Shahriari&#8217;s own admissions are just as damaging. Recalling nuclear diplomacy in Europe, he let slip who guarded the Foreign Minister: Zarif&#8217;s detail &#8220;were Revolutionary Guard boys who did not share his views,&#8221; listening at the door until two in the morning. Diplomatic missions, by his own account, are IRGC operations with a diplomat inside. He then asked Sabeti whether dissenters in Iran are permitted to speak \u2014 &#8220;Don&#8217;t you arrest them?&#8221; \u2014 and, describing his years as a provincial governor, asked who his real overseers were: &#8220;Those who used to fabricate false case files \u2014 who were they?&#8221; He added that Hassan Rouhani cannot get airtime to answer his accusers. This is an insider testifying to censorship, surveillance and manufactured prosecutions.<\/p>\n<p>The numbers they traded describe a state in liquidation: a country run on thirty billion dollars a year; wartime damage Shahriari puts at <a href=\"https:\/\/www.wsj.com\/livecoverage\/iran-us-cease-fire-talks-stalled-2026\/card\/iran-estimates-war-losses-at-270-billion-GIhzGnNEId1ut11TkSde\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">$270\u2013300 billion<\/a>, &#8220;ten years of our budget&#8221;; twenty villages in his own district without water and no five hundred billion tomans to fix it; a parliament shuttered for five months; a president Sabeti says is &#8220;sitting in a chair that is not his at all.&#8221;<\/p>\n<blockquote class=\"twitter-tweet\" data-width=\"550\" data-dnt=\"true\">\n<p lang=\"en\" dir=\"ltr\">&quot;A brewing <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/hashtag\/diplomatic?src=hash&amp;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">#diplomatic<\/a> settlement between Tehran and Washington has ignited an unprecedented domestic crisis within the Iranian regime, exposing severe structural fractures at the highest levels of the clerical establishment,&quot; <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/HakamianMahmoud?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">@HakamianMahmoud<\/a> writes.<a href=\"https:\/\/t.co\/FNT4uPeG5t\">https:\/\/t.co\/FNT4uPeG5t<\/a><\/p>\n<p>&mdash; NCRI-FAC (@iran_policy) <a href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/iran_policy\/status\/2066500971379757293?ref_src=twsrc%5Etfw\">June 15, 2026<\/a><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><script async src=\"https:\/\/platform.x.com\/widgets.js\" charset=\"utf-8\"><\/script><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">And they know the street, where regime loyal but demoralized base is supposed to show force, is shrinking day by day. Shahriari, to Sabeti&#8217;s face: &#8220;You burned the mascot of our officials in the streets, and the people came to hate you \u2014 every night the crowd in the square gets smaller.&#8221; Then the dare no regime official makes about a healthy society: &#8220;Do you dare hold a referendum?&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The programme was clearly intended to project an image of a strong and united regime. Instead, two hours of <a href=\"https:\/\/www.aparat.com\/v\/gox61c9\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">televised knife-work<\/a>, exposed the exact opposite: the economy broken, the leader bypassed, the parliament closed, diplomacy run by the Guard, dissent jailed \u2014 and the squares emptying. Far from demonstrating confidence or cohesion, the debate revealed a system weakened by deep internal fractures. This was not a debate about strategy. It was an argument about who to blame when the structure falls.
